Transaction 3454118762d6b4c923193f6e581b2432a3270d4e7489fc81cb5baa9af6ec701b

3 Input
2 Outputs
  • 3454118762d6b4c923193f6e581b2432a3270d4e7489fc81cb5baa9af6ec701b:0
  • value  330000000
    address  3EQSFKY4owYRnKehcQcKgYwRTtaQC5nM1y
  • 3454118762d6b4c923193f6e581b2432a3270d4e7489fc81cb5baa9af6ec701b:1
  • value  62691474
    address  3BMEXSg3EswDm2BfC2vrUkZpxApN4t2DK3